night colors drip from the hand not raised from the smile unfazed by the empty space that lay beside me nightmares slip into my soul resigned into my world designed to hold in dreams the love denied me waking to the burning light her voice now fades from blue to white her smile a thought so quickly gone a memory lost again to dawn
